[infinispan-issues] [JBoss JIRA] Resolved: (ISPN-314) Enhance test fwk to report when a resource was not properly cleaned by a test

Mircea Markus resolved ISPN-314.
--------------------------------

    Resolution: Done


I've added a sanity check to verify weather all the CacheManagers created by a test are being shutdown within the same test[1].
The cool part is that if a CM is not being closed, the fwk will report you where the unclosed CacheManager was created (java file and line, see bellow), so that you don't have to spend too much time looking into code ;)
E.g.

[pool-2-thread-7] Test testTxChangesOnAtomicMap(org.infinispan.atomic.AtomicMapFunctionalTest) succeeded.
Test suite progress: tests succeeded: 179, failed: 1, skipped: 0.
[pool-2-thread-7] Test testTxChangesOnAtomicMapNoLocks(org.infinispan.atomic.AtomicMapFunctionalTest) succeeded.
Test suite progress: tests succeeded: 180, failed: 1, skipped: 0.

!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!
!!!!!! (pool-2-thread-7) Exiting because atomic.AtomicMapFunctionalTest has NOT shut down all the cache managers it has started !!!!!!!
!!!!!! (pool-2-thread-7) The still-running cacheManager was created here: org.infinispan.atomic.AtomicMapFunctionalTest.setUp(AtomicMapFunctionalTest.java:33) !!!!!!!
!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!

>  if  a test fails and didn't clean up resources properly (in this case destroy the cache managers) then next test running on the same thread will see the already existing cluster, and blockUntil.. methods will fail.
> Make the fwk report that a cluster is not properly shutdown by a test, when another tries to create a cluster.
